As nouns, tobacco is a hypernym of flowering tobacco; that is, tobacco is a word with a broader meaning than flowering tobacco:
  • flowering tobacco: South American ornamental perennial having nocturnally fragrant greenish-white flowers
  • tobacco: aromatic annual or perennial herbs and shrubs
Other hypernyms of flowering tobacco include tobacco plant.
